Kangkalang is a word that does not exist in conventional English dictionaries. It originates in Trinidad & Tobago and has several meanings depending on it's context and usage. Most commonly kangkalang refers to 'confusion'. But 'confusion' does not have the same nuance of meanings as in conventional English.
